60,000 Volts in First Year?


Bloomberg's Jeff Green is reporting that a super-secret source at GM is claiming that they could build up to 60,000 Chevy Volts in their inaugural year of production which is slated for 2010. According to the source, it is partly because they believe the demand is going to be there and it is partly in order to drop the price on the plug-in to under $30,000 per unit. To put that number of units in perspective, that's FOUR TIMES the number of Toyota Prius hybrids sold in the first year they were on sale here in the US, so selling 60,000 is no small feet.

If they are able to move that number of vehicles, GM might be able to sell the plug-in Volt for less than $30,000, said Bloomberg's sources, who didn't want to be identified. The discussions show the Detroit automaker believes an affordable electric car will help spur a revival said the confidental insider source. Toyota's Prius can be bought for $22,175.
